Transaction 11532295911aeabf1f6312fc46730007d88980420f40b434a881073034700c06

1 Input
2 Outputs
  • 11532295911aeabf1f6312fc46730007d88980420f40b434a881073034700c06:0
  • value  18683
    address  12Guny2Ya2QMsKZB7HHHEsq5mp6GdJeZ7x
  • 11532295911aeabf1f6312fc46730007d88980420f40b434a881073034700c06:1
  • value  114320
    address  178KCKFXPzfDMPysmgqvfZM65Fodd72n8J